The week of April 13-29, 2025, marks the time of year when we recognize the invaluable service that our Public Safety Communications Centre (PSCC) operators in Saint John and across the country provide to our officers and the community. 

The PSCC is a critical part of the Saint John Police operations. It is responsible for providing emergency and non-emergency call-taking and dispatching services 24 hours a day, 7 days a week.

In addition to the Saint John Police, the PSCC is a Public Safety Answering Point (PSAP) for the Province of New Brunswick responsible for answering 911 calls regionally from St. Stephen to Sussex. Additionally, they provide emergency and non-emergency call taking and dispatching services for the Saint John Fire Department and 34 other fire departments between St. Stephen and Sussex. 

The members of the Saint John Public Safety Communications Centre provide a vital link to the community, police, and fire.
